SGGDX vs STAG: Complete Analysis 2026

SGGDXStock

The investment seeks to provide investors the opportunity to participate in the investment characteristics of gold for a portion of their overall investment portfolio. To achieve its objective of providing investors the opportunity to participate in the investment characteristics of gold, the fund invests at least 80% of its net assets (plus any borrowings for investment purposes) in gold and/or securities directly related to gold or issuers principally engaged in the gold industry, including securities of gold mining finance companies as well as operating companies with long-, medium- or short-life mines. The fund is non-diversified.

STAGREIT

STAG Industrial, Inc. (NYSE: STAG) is a real estate investment trust focused on the acquisition and operation of single-tenant, industrial properties throughout the United States. By targeting this type of property, STAG has developed an investment strategy that helps investors find a powerful balance of income plus growth.
